Thomas Turino

Thomas Turino (born December 12, 1951) is an American ethnomusicologist and author of several textbooks in the field, most notably the popular introductory book ''Music as Social Life: The Politics of Participation''. His interests include the growth of nationalism through music and the role that music plays in creating the connections that define a society. Provided by Wikipedia
